Grimsby-based Splash About announces acquisition and turnaround of reusable nappy brand

Grimsby-headquartered Splash About, a leader in the early years swimwear and learn-to-swim market, has announced its acquisition and turnaround of Bambino Mio, which has been at the forefront of the reusable nappy market for over 25 years.

Bambino Mio will operate as a ‘sister’ brand to Splash About, leveraging its operational expertise, innovation and strong multi-channel distribution. With a shared ethos and complementary strengths, the deal strategically positions the brands to accelerate international growth and capture a greater share of the eco-conscious parenting market.

The deal has created more investment in the area with Splash About taking on a lease for a 30,000 sq ft warehouse and office space to accommodate the new acquisition. Bambino Mio’s logistics and distribution have all been moved to Stallingborough, creating new employment and further opportunities in the region.

Splash About acquired Bambino Mio from administration in December 2024 and has spent the past 8 months implementing a focused strategy that has resulted in returning the business to profitability.

Group managing director Lesley Beach explained: “A deep dive financial diagnostic of the business identified the profit and loss drivers, which in turn resulted in a complete overhaul of the product range – returning to what Bambino Mio always did best; beautiful mix and match designs of eco-friendly developmental products.”

Lesley continued: “We have taken this starting point but gone one step further, creating an improved technical spec at reduced cost prices. We are now confident this range of reusable nappies and potty training pants are best in class in their market category – and we will be unveiling our new collection to retailers attending the Kind + Jugend Baby and Toddler International Trade Fair in Cologne this September.”
